Has anyone successfully created a GA → Notion zap? I have one set up, and everything checks out with the zap history, but the main column keeps coming up blank. I’m sure it’s user error, but I don’t know what I’m doing wrong.

Here’s the zap for reference:

Hi @bennbennett 

I’d be better if you could post screenshots of how your Zap steps are configured, thanks.

FYI: Zap Share links don’t include the mapped data points, only the Zap steps.

Hi @bennbennett 

You need to map data points between the Zap steps.

Thanks! For me, it wasn’t obvious how to map the data points until I dug a bit deeper here: https://zapier.com/blog/build-google-assistant-automations-zapier/

 

I had to put “Placeholder Value” as the “task” (i.e. primary column in notion). Works perfectly now!
